Expanding Microdrama's Global Reach in Brazil

ReelShort and Endemol Shine Brasil are making a strategic move to localize the highly successful microdrama 'Married at First Sight' for the Brazilian market, demonstrating a keen understanding of global entertainment trends and the increasing importance of regional content adaptation. This 89-episode series, titled 'De Repente Casados,' is set to debut on April 18, exclusively on ReelShort. The initiative is a direct response to Brazil's emergence as a mobile-first entertainment hub, where audiences are increasingly consuming content on their devices. By leveraging Endemol Shine Brasil's profound expertise in adapting international formats and producing culturally relevant narratives, this partnership aims to broaden ReelShort's global footprint and connect with a wider, diverse viewership through authentic storytelling.

The adaptation highlights the evolving landscape of digital media, where microdramas have found a significant niche due to their bite-sized, engaging format suitable for mobile consumption. The original 'Married at First Sight' has already garnered over 227 million global views since its 2023 release, proving the format's universal appeal. A Deep Dive into "De Repente Casados" Narrative and Production

'De Repente Casados,' the Brazilian adaptation of 'Married at First Sight,' promises a compelling romantic drama starring Laryssa Ayres as Sabrina and Ricardo Vianna as Christian Noronha Jr., with veteran actor Adriano Garib in a special role. Directed by Rogério Passos, a prominent figure in Brazilian television, the series delves into the life of Sabrina, who, after a devastating betrayal, finds her world entangled with the cold, calculating billionaire CEO, Christian. Faced with familial pressure to marry for business stability, Christian proposes a marriage of convenience, setting the stage for a narrative rich with emotional conflict and plot twists, exploring themes of redemption, power, identity, and the possibility of transforming an arranged union into genuine love.
